Cuxhaven Port Expands to Meet Germany's Offshore Wind Energy Demands
Germany's Cuxhaven port is building three new berths and 54 soccer-field-sized terminal areas (€300 million) to handle the growing demand for offshore wind turbine components, enabling larger vessels and boosting the region's economy by 2028.
- What is the significance of the expansion of Cuxhaven port for Germany's offshore wind energy goals?
- The German port of Cuxhaven is expanding its capacity for offshore wind energy logistics with three new berths and 54 soccer-field-sized terminal areas, costing approximately €300 million. This expansion, completed by the end of 2028, is driven by the rising demand for handling and storage of wind turbine components. The project will increase the port's capacity to handle larger vessels, including Jack-Up ships.

- This expansion in Cuxhaven directly responds to Germany's ambitious offshore wind energy targets: 30 GW by 2030 and 70 GW by 2045. The new berths, capable of accommodating vessels up to 300 meters long, will facilitate the import and processing of wind turbine components, attracting businesses and creating jobs in the region. This infrastructure investment underscores the strategic importance of Cuxhaven as a logistics hub for the burgeoning offshore wind industry in Europe.
